Step-by-Step Migration

1

Export Your Contacts from GetResponse

Navigate to GetResponse's Contacts menu, select your primary audience list, and click Export (top right). Download as CSV with all custom fields and tags intact. 6

Point DNS Records (DKIM/SPF) to AlpacaRelay and Monitor Warm-up

In AlpacaRelay, go to Account Settings > Email Authentication. Copy your DKIM and SPF records and add them to your domain provider (GoDaddy, Namecheap, etc.). This step takes 10 minutes but unlocks AI-monitored deliverability. Expect a 2–4 week warm-up period: ISPs rebuild trust with the new sending infrastructure, and average inbox placement may dip 5–8% initially (this is normal and temporary). Send your first AlpacaRelay campaigns to your most engaged 10–20% of subscribers during weeks 1–2, then expand to the full list once EQS monitoring shows stable 90+ scores. Migration FAQ
What format does GetResponse use for contact exports, and will my data import cleanly into AlpacaRelay?
GetResponse exports contacts as CSV files from Contacts > All Contacts > Export. AlpacaRelay accepts standard CSV imports with columns for email, first name, last name, and custom fields. The import process maps automatically, though you should verify custom field names match before uploading. One critical note: GetResponse does not export automation state or engagement history, so imported contacts start fresh in AlpacaRelay. How does AlpacaRelay handle double opt-in for imported GetResponse subscribers?
Imported contacts retain their opt-in status from GetResponse—confirmed subscribers import as confirmed, unconfirmed as unconfirmed. AlpacaRelay does not re-trigger opt-in flows unless you manually assign them to a double opt-in automation. However, you should manually run a list verification 48 hours before your first send from AlpacaRelay to ensure inbox placement. This verification step catches dead addresses and reduces the typical 2-4 week deliverability warm-up period. Will my deliverability suffer during migration, and how do I recover my inbox placement rate?
Yes, expect a temporary deliverability dip of 5-15% for 2-4 weeks when you switch sending infrastructure from GetResponse to AlpacaRelay. ISPs need to build trust with AlpacaRelay's IP addresses and domain authentication. Here is the recovery process: Week 1, send only to your top 20% most-engaged subscribers (openers, clickers); Week 2, expand to top 40%; Week 3-4, expand to full list. Simultaneously, verify DKIM, SPF, and DMARC records are properly configured—this takes 2 hours and is non-negotiable. Industry benchmarks show the global average inbox placement rate is 83.5 percent, with 1 in 6 marketing emails never reaching the inbox (Validity, 2025). AlpacaRelay's Structural Compliance scoring catches pre-send deliverability blockers (authentication gaps, trigger words, broken links), which shortens your warm-up by 1-2 weeks. Do not cancel GetResponse until Week 4 when your AlpacaRelay placement rate stabilizes above 90%.
